Amelie Mauresmo- Winner of two-time Grand Slam
- Winner of A ustralian Open (2006)
- Winner of Wimbledon (2006) .
- Former world number one
- Spent a total of 39 weeks atop in the rankings in 2004 and 2006
- Won a Silver Medal at the 2004 Summer Olympics
- Third French women tennis player to win a Grand Slam title in the Open Era
- She retired in 2009 and had a career of more than 15 years.
Along with Amelie Mauresmo, Australian 6 time Paralympic medalist David Hall was also an included into the International Tennis Hall of Fame.
